Ko Seok-hyeon vs. Oban Elliott: A Battle of Grit and Skill in the Octagon
In a thrilling matchup at UFC Fight Night in Baku, Azerbaijan, South Korea's Ko Seok-hyeon showcased his talent and determination, defeating Welsh fighter Oban Elliott by a unanimous decision (30-27). This victory marked a significant milestone in Ko's career as it was his UFC debut, and he did not hold back, demonstrating a masterful performance that kept fans on the edge of their seats. Pre-Fight Context: The Build-Up to the Match
The lead-up to the fight was filled with anticipation as both fighters entered the octagon with impressive records. Ko Seok-hyeon, known as "The Korean Tyson," came into this bout with an impressive 11-2 record, showcasing his skills and readiness to compete at the highest level. On the other hand, Oban Elliott, nicknamed "The Welsh Gangster," entered the fight with a perfect 3-0 record in the UFC, including a knockout victory that had garnered him attention in the MMA community.
Oban Elliott: The Welsh Gangster's Journey
Oban Elliott's journey to the octagon has been filled with hard work, resilience, and determination. After debuting in the UFC in February 2024, Elliott quickly made a name for himself with his knockout power and technical skills. His previous victories included impressive performances against fighters like Bassil Hafez, Preston Parsons, and Val Woodburn. Elliott's training regimen spanned across Europe, where he trained with some of the elite fighters in the sport, allowing him to prepare thoroughly for his matchup against Ko.

The Fight: A Display of Dominance
As the fight commenced, it became clear that Ko Seok-hyeon was determined to make his debut memorable. From the outset, he took control of the pace and positioning, employing a strategy that kept Elliott on the defensive. Ko's ability to maintain dominant positions on the ground allowed him to implement a series of submissions that tested Elliott's resilience.
Round-by-Round Breakdown
Here's a closer look at how each round unfolded:
- Round 1: Ko started strong, immediately seeking to establish his dominance in the fight. He utilized effective takedowns and ground control, showcasing his grappling skills. Elliott struggled to find his rhythm, spending significant time on the defensive.
- Round 2: The second round saw more of the same from Ko. He continued to apply pressure, and his ground control was evident. Elliott attempted to mount a counter-offensive, but Ko's grappling prowess kept him at bay, leading to more submission attempts.
- Round 3: In the final round, Ko maintained his composure and continued to execute his game plan. Elliott showed heart and determination, trying to fend off Ko's advances, but the relentless pressure from Ko ultimately sealed the fight in his favor.
